Transfer talk: Real Madrid or Bayern Munich? Kroos’s future to be decided



BAYERN MUNICH & REAL MADRID

Toni Kroos’ future will be resolved by Wednesday at the latest, with the Germany international’s agent denying an agreement has already been reached with Real Madrid.

Kroos is out of contract with Bayern Munich in a year’s time and is in all likelihood set to leave the club this summer.

It has been reported that the 24-year-old has agreed terms with Real, and that Bayern had also accepted an offer from the Champions League holders.

However, his agent Volker Struth says nothing has yet been signed and that he will discuss the future with Kroos on his return from Brazil on Tuesday.

“It has not yet been decided where Kroos’ future lies, I can guarantee that,” Struth told the Express newspaper.

Struth says Kroos will meet with him in Majorca on Tuesday, after his and the rest of the World Cup-winning Germany team’s welcome back in Berlin, and a decision will be made within 24 hours.

“We’ll sit down and decide what’s to be done,” he said. “We will announce his decision either on Tuesday evening or Wednesday morning.”

Valencia coach Nuno Espirito Santo has denied that defender Jeremy Mathieu missed training because he is preparing for a move to Barcelona.

The French centre-back was a notable absence from Sunday’s preseason training session in Germany, staying in the team’s hotel despite no indication that he was injured.

Mathieu has been touted as one of Barcelona’s top transfer targets this summer as they seek to strengthen their defence following the retirement of veteran captain Carles Puyol, but Valencia president Amadeo Salvo has said that the club will only sell Mathieu, 30, if the Catalans pay his €20 million (Dh100m) release clause.

The defender’s absence from training inevitably generated suspicions a move to Camp Nou was imminent.

Nuno sought to cool the speculation yesterday.

“He is a Valencia player, but we thought it was opportune that he rested so he would be in perfect conditions today,” said the Portuguese coach, who took over the club earlier this month following the sacking of Juan Antonio Pizzi.

Nuno takes charge of his first Valencia game today against Bavarian minnows SpVgg Bayreuth, who play in Germany’s regionalised fourth tier.

Next is Bundesliga side Nurnberg and then the club heads to Peru and Chile for pre-season games with Allianza Lima and Universidad Catolica. After that they will take part in the Emirates Cup at Arsenal’s Emirates Stadium in August.

Midfielder Ever Banega has returned to Valencia following a loan spell with Newell’s Old Boys in Argentina and travelled to Germany with the team, as has new signing Nicolas Otamendi and forward Carles Gil, recalled from Elche.

Nuno said that there would be changes to the squad between now and the start of the summer but said no decisions had been made yet. The club have sold left-back Juan Bernat to Bayern Munich and last week parted ways with Adil Rami, who has joined AC Milan permanently.

NEWCASTLE UNITED

Remy Cabella has completed his move to Newcastle to hand manager Alan Pardew a massive boost.

The Magpies confirmed on Sunday night that the 24-year-old has signed a six-year contract after sealing his transfer from French club Montpellier for an undisclosed fee.

Cabella, who has been in the club’s sights since they tried to sign him as a replacement for Yohan Cabaye in January, becomes Pardew’s fourth summer acquisition after Siem de Jong, Jack Colback and Ayoze Perez.

Cabella said: “It is great to finally be a Newcastle player.

“This is a move that I really wanted to make as I have heard nothing but good things about Newcastle United from everyone I spoke to.

“I wanted to join a great English club and that is why I have arrived here. I’m looking forward to pulling on the shirt and playing in this magnificent stadium, and I will give this club my maximum.”

WEST HAM UNITED

Pachuca striker Enner Valencia is undergoing a medical at West Ham, Press Association Sport understands.

The 25-year-old scored all three of Ecuador’s World Cup goals, attracting the attention of a number of Barclays Premier League suitors in the process.

It now appears that West Ham have won the race to sign Valencia - who will become manager Sam Allardyce’s fifth summer signing if the deal is completed following Monday’s medical.

FIORENTINA

Argentina defender Gonzalo Rodriguez has pledged his future to Fiorentina by signing a two-year contract extension.

The 30-year-old central defender had one year left in his previous deal but the new agreement will keep him with the Florence club until June 2017.

“I am delighted,” Rodriguez said accffiorentina.it. “There were never any doubts from my part.

“I had other offers but as soon as I was told that Fiorentina still wanted me, I immediately accepted.”

Rodriguez joined Fiorentina in 2012 from Spanish outfit Villarreal and scored four goals in 33 league appearances to help the Viola finish fourth in Serie A.

“We want to improve with respect to last season,” Rodriguez said.

CSKA MOSCOW

Russian CSKA Moscow’s Brazilian defender Mario Fernandes has said he is considering playing for Russia at international level.

“Of course I’ve been always dreaming of playing for my native country since I’ve been a child,” the Sport-Express quoted the 23-year-old back as saying.

“But the competition for a place in the Brazilian squad is incredibly high and I’m ready to consider the possibility of plating for Russia if I am asked.

“The top Brazilian guys that are currently playing at my position - Dani Alves, Maicon, Rafinha, Rafael da Silva - are all unbelieveably talented.

“I still hope that some day the Lord will give me a chance and I’ll receive a call into the Brazilian squad. But I don’t want to wait for this chance until the end of my career.”

BARCELONA

Bojan Krkic could play a part in new coach Luis Enrique’s Barcelona squad.

Barcelona loaned Krkic out to Dutch champions Ajax last season after the striker, 23, failed to make an impact at his boyhood club or during spells with AC Milan and Roma in Italy.

Krkic was among several new additions at Barcelona yesterday as Gerard Deulofeu, Rafinha, and goalkeeper Marc-Andre Ter Stegen also had medicals at the club’s training facility.

Enrique takes charge of the squad today when the team begins training for the 2014/15 season.
